Bobby Causby

January 1, 1943 — January 2, 2015

KINGS MOUNTAIN- Bobby William Causby, 72, of 105 McGinnis Street, left this world to go to his eternal home Friday, January 2, 2015 at his residence. A native of Cleveland County, he was born January 1, 1943, son of the late William “Jake” Harrison and Maggie Lee Carroll Causby. He was a good hearted man who loved his family. He was a man who was full of life and loved doing for others. He loved the outdoors and anything to do with the outdoors from whitewater rafting to cutting wood to having huge cookouts inviting anyone and everyone, the more the merrier. He was a simple man who wore his overalls every day. He will be loved and missed by all who knew him.

PRECEDED: In addition to his parents, he is preceded in death by three brothers, Dean Causby, Roy Dean White, and David Causby; one sister, Ruth Brackett; two grandsons and one granddaughter.

SURVIVORS: He is survived by his wife of 52 years Judy Bell Causby and a great granddaughter Karena Causby of the home; four daughters, Roxanne Wright of Kings Mountain, Tammy Ruyle of Denver, Bobbie Jo Causby of Kings Mountain, and Bobbie Ann Biddix of Clover, SC; one son, Marty Lockridge of Kings Mountain; two brothers, Richard Causby of Shelby and Pete Causby of Bellwood; five sisters, Doris Bridges of Shelby, Ruby Rector of Conley Springs, Inez Smith, Faye Martin, and Ann Ruyle all of Caser; two son-in-laws, Michael “Tony” Wright of Kings Mountain and Gary Ruyle of Caser; ten grandchildren; nine great grandchildren.
